Bo Lueders Band Gains National Attention After Viral Festival Performance

The Bo Lueders Band, a rising indie folk group, has captured national attention following a standout performance at the Austin City Limits Music Festival this past weekend. The band’s emotionally charged set, featuring their hit single "Golden Hours," quickly went viral on social media, sparking widespread praise from fans and critics alike.

Based in Austin, Texas, the five-member band has been steadily gaining traction in the indie music scene since their debut album in 2022. However, their recent festival appearance has catapulted them into the mainstream spotlight. Videos of their performance have amassed millions of views on platforms like TikTok and Instagram, with many praising their raw energy and lyrical depth.

The band’s sudden surge in popularity comes at a time when indie folk music is experiencing a resurgence in the US. Fans have flooded streaming platforms, pushing their latest EP, "Echoes in the Canyon," into the top 10 on Spotify’s US charts. Music critics have also noted the band’s ability to blend introspective storytelling with lush, melodic arrangements.

Bo Lueders, the band’s frontman and namesake, expressed gratitude for the overwhelming response. "We’ve always believed in the power of music to connect people," he said in a statement. "Seeing our songs resonate with so many is incredibly humbling."

The band’s newfound fame has also sparked conversations about the future of indie music in the digital age. Industry experts suggest their success highlights the growing influence of social media in breaking new artists. "Platforms like TikTok are reshaping how music is discovered and shared," said music analyst Rachel Carter. "The Bo Lueders Band is a perfect example of how authenticity can cut through the noise."

As of today, the band has announced a nationwide tour scheduled to kick off in June 2026. Tickets are expected to sell out quickly, with fans eager to experience their live performances firsthand. For now, the Bo Lueders Band continues to ride the wave of their viral moment, proving that heartfelt music still has the power to captivate audiences across the country.
